Inside Highgate
from a local eye view

Sitting high on a hill over looking the Capital, with the bustle of central London just a stone's throw away, and glorious Hampstead Heath right on our doorstep, it's easy to see how Highgate got its reputation as London's 'green lung', (a phrase coined by violinist, humanist and Highgate Society patron Yehudi Menuhin). Highgate's excellent position and unique character has attracted artists and creative types throughout its history, from Dickens, TS Eliot and Betjeman, to George Michael, Victoria Wood and Sting. Highgate is a real London village, but in place of the pretence of comparable areas, you'll find a relaxed, almost bohemian atmosphere. Yes, there are fine houses but without the Mayfair millionaire prices. We also boast great schools and a rich cultural scene and good shops to boot, within the village or within easy reach. All of which makes Highgate the ideal place for working people and couples, families, empty nesters and retirees.
